The contest is open to participants worldwide, including SWLs. |
- A. Licenced members of a club affiliated to EUCW using 150 W HF or more.
- B. Licenced members of a club affiliated to EUCW using 10 to 150 W HF.
- C. The same, but using 10 W HF or less.
- D. Other stations, no power limitations.
- E. S.W.L.
|
- Classes A,B & C: RST / name / Club / membership number.
- Class D: RST / name / NM (non-member).
- Class E: Full report on each station in QSO.
|
- Classes A,B,C & D:
- 1 point per QSO with a station in the same DXCC entity.
- 2 points per QSO with a station in another DXCC entity but in same continent.
- 5 points per QSO with a station in another continent.
- Class E:
- 2 points for each complete report.
- All Classes:
- 10 points for each official EUCW club station,
e.g. F8UFT, DKØAG, DLØHSC, DLØRTC, DLØDA... (New rule since 2003)
A QSO with the same station may be made on Saturday and again on Sunday. |
One multiplier par EUCW Club contacted per day. |
The number of points multiplied by the number of multipliers. |
